Tungsten Alloy Ray Shielding Block has a series of advantages of tungsten alloy, such as high density, high shielding level, strong impact resistance, good corrosion resistance, easy cleaning, environmental protection, non-toxic, and long service life etc. Tungsten Alloy Ray Shielding Block is widely used in the nuclear industry, geological exploration, aerospace industry, and medical imaging. For example, in medical treatment, Tungsten Alloy Ray Shielding Block can be used as containers such as tungsten alloy multi-leaf grating, shielded needle tubes, tungsten alloy storage or dispensing tank, etc. In geological exploration, they can be used to make tungsten alloy collimators.
High density: The density of tungsten alloy is usually 16.5-18.75g/cm³, which is 60% higher than that of lead (about 11.34g/cm³). Under the same shielding effect, the volume of the tungsten alloy shielding block is less than 1/3 of that of lead.
High radiation shielding: Tungsten has a high atomic number (Z=74) and a large electron cloud density, which can effectively absorb and scatter high-energy rays, including X-rays, gamma rays, etc. For example, to block 150keV gamma rays, the thickness of attenuation by 90% only needs to be 3mm.
Good mechanical properties: Tungsten alloy has high strength, high hardness, and good wear resistance, and can maintain a stable shape and size during long-term use, reducing the maintenance and replacement costs of equipment.
Corrosion resistance: It can resist the erosion of various chemical media such as acids and alkalis at room temperature, which has obvious advantages over ordinary materials such as steel.
Environmental protection: Tungsten alloy itself is not toxic and does not produce radioactive substances. Compared with traditional lead materials, it is more environmentally friendly.
Used to manufacture shielding components for medical linear accelerators, multi-leaf gratings, X-ray therapy machines, etc., which can reduce particle beams or light waves, direct the rays in a specific direction, and improve the accuracy of treatment. As shielding components for CT tomography scanners, it absorbs X-rays that pass through the human body to protect patients and medical staff. Used to hold radioactive drugs to prevent leakage of radioactive substances.
